What You’ll Walk Away With
By the end of the six months, each participant will complete a practical Artist Operating Plan that includes:
A Defined Brand and Musical Lane
Get clear on your positioning, your story, your audience, and how to talk about your music in a way that connects.
A Repeatable Content System
Develop a sustainable approach to short-form content, storytelling, and audience engagement without reinventing the wheel every week.
A Release Blueprint
Create a realistic release plan with timeline, assets, admin readiness, and distribution preparation.
A Post-Release Growth Plan
Map out how you will continue promoting your music, building relationships, and creating momentum after release day.
A Live Strategy
Build a more intentional approach to booking, pitching, performance opportunities, and content capture around live shows.
Meet the Instructor
Clay Myers
Founder and CEO of Nashville Music Consultants
Clay Myers is a music industry veteran with more than 30 years of experience in artist development, music publishing, artist management, and television production.
He began his Nashville career working with ALABAMA, later held key roles at Reba McEntire’s Starstruck Entertainment and Creative Artists Agency (CAA), and helped oversee a writing staff that produced major hits, including Taylor Swift’s BMI Song of the Year, “You Belong With Me.”
Myers has also served as Talent Producer for seven seasons of THE SONG and worked with CMT and Circle Network on multiple music-based series.
A passionate advocate for emerging talent, Myers brings decades of real-world industry experience to helping artists grow their careers.
